The Range (Statistics)
The Range is the difference between the lowest and highest values. In 4, 6, 9, 3, 7 the lowest value is 3, and the highest is 9.

Range Formula - What is Range Formula?, Examples
The formula is given as, Range = Highest Value - Lowest Value ... No, the number cannot be negative since the range formula subtracts the lowest number from the highest number. The range can be either a zero or a positive number.

How to find Range of function
One way to do it is by inverting the function (swap x and y, then solve for y). The domain of the inverted function will be the range of the original function. Ex: y = x2 + 3, find domain and range This function doesn’t have anywhere where you would be dividing by 0 or taking the square root of a negative, so the domain is (-inf, inf) To find range, first invert function x = y2 + 3 => y2 = x - 3 => y = sqrt(x - 3) The range will be the domain of this inverted function. For x<3, you would be taking the square root of a negative, so the domain of the inverted function is [3, inf). That is the range of the original function. More on reddit.com

How do you find range and domain in general?
Domain is the set of possible X values in a function. Range is the set of possible Y values in a function. To find the domain, set the denominator equal to zero and then solve for X. Whatever X is is what CANNOT be in the domain. For example: 1/x, the domain is all real numbers except 0 because the denominator cannot be equal to zero. (Cannot divide by zero.) And easier, if there is no denominator and no square roots or anything like that, you know the domain is all real numbers. The range is easier to decipher by graphing. 4.5.1 Calculating the range and interquartile range
To calculate the range, you need to find the largest observed value of a variable (the maximum) and subtract the smallest observed value (the minimum). The range only takes into account these two values and ignore the data points between the two extremities of the distribution.
